![]() |
|
|
google unix.com
|
|||||||
| Forums | Registrer | Forum Rules | Lenker | Album | FAQ | Medlemsliste | Kalender | Søke | Dagens innlegg | Marker forumene som lest |
| Shell programmering og Skripting Post spørsmål om ksh, csh, SH, Bash, Perl, PHP, SED, awk og ANDRE shell scripts og Shell skriptespråk her. |
Mer UNIX og Linux Forum Emner Du kan finne nyttig
|
||||
| Tråd | Tråd startet | Forum | Svar | Siste innlegg |
| Shell script til å lage en kobling | Shreedhar Naik | Shell programmering og Skripting | 3 | 05-22-2008 08:01 |
| shell script til å lage dirs | sjajimi | Shell programmering og Skripting | 2 | 07-24-2007 08:34 |
| opprette et shell script | maykap100 | Shell programmering og Skripting | 3 | 08-31-2005 11:17 |
| Shell script til å lage lokale boliger | Steve Adcock | Shell programmering og Skripting | 11 | 10-25-2004 05:18 |
| Shell skript for å lage en DOS-liknende Menutiem | bionicfysh | Shell programmering og Skripting | 2 | 06-17-2002 05:03 |
|
|
LinkBack | Thread Tools | Søk i denne tråden | Rate Thread | Visningsmoduser |
|
||||
|
opprette et shell script som kaller et annet script, og en awk script
Hei folkens
Jeg har et shell script som kjører SQL statemets og sender utdata til en file.the skript tar inn parametere utfører SQL og sender resultatet til en utfil. #! / bin / sh echo "$ 2 $ 3 $ 4 $ 5 $ 6 $ 7 isql-w400-U $ 2-kr 5-P $ 3 <<xxx bruke $ 4 dra print "** Endringer i tabellen ************" select * fra kontantstrømmen der label \u003d 'DEALS' dra xxx Jeg har også en Awk skript som tar utgang produsert av skriptet ovenfor og genererer en CSV-fil fra den og sender utdata til en annen fil som CSV. BEGIN ( count \u003d 0; ) /^[^(]/ ( count + \u003d 1 if (teller> 1) ( for (i \u003d 1; i <\u003d NF; i \u003d i + 1) printf ( "% s", $ i); printf ( "\ n"); ) ) Mitt problem er. 1. Hvordan kaller jeg den første skriptet fra et annet shell script som passerer i de nødvendige parametrene. 2.how ho jeg kaller Awk skriptet etter utgang ovenfra å behandle filen og produserer en CSV file.this må være i samme skriften som ovenfor. 3.my Hovedproblemet er hvordan du gjør det over fra ONE shell script. 4.some dato blir prcessed av Awk skriptet er i datetime format.the Awk skriften skiller dag, måned og år med comma.How gjør jeg det behandle 23-06-2008 så enkelt felt og ikke som separate felt. Takk. |
| Hugseliste |
| Thread Tools | Søk i denne tråden |
| Visningsmoduser | Ranger denne tråden |
|
|